Technical Lead, YouTube Ads Data Infrastructure
Google's software engineers develop the next-generation technologies that change how billions of users connect, explore, and interact with information and one another. Our products need to handle information at massive scale, and extend well beyond web search. We're looking for engineers who bring fresh ideas from all areas, including information retrieval, distributed computing, large-scale system design, networking and data storage, security, artificial intelligence, natural language processing, UI design and mobile; the list goes on and is growing every day. As a software engineer, you will work on a specific project critical to Google’s needs with opportunities to switch teams and projects as you and our fast-paced business grow and evolve. We need our engineers to be versatile, display leadership qualities and be enthusiastic to take on new problems across the full-stack as we continue to push technology forward.
As a member of the YouTube Ads Data Infrastructure team, you will design and scale the critical data systems that power everything from ads model training and analytics to billing and reporting. You will have an opportunity to gain a deep understanding of the YouTube Ads stack while collaborating with various product teams to engineer the data infrastructure of the future.
Google Ads is helping power the open internet with the best technology that connects and creates value for people, publishers, advertisers, and Google. We’re made up of multiple teams, building Google’s Advertising products including search, display, shopping, travel and video advertising, as well as analytics. Our teams create trusted experiences between people and businesses with useful ads. We help grow businesses of all sizes from small businesses, to large brands, to YouTube creators, with effective advertiser tools that deliver measurable results. We also enable Google to engage with customers at scale.
Individual pay is determined by factors including job-related skills, experience, and relevant education or training.US: $207000 - $301000 (USD) + 20% bonus target + equity + benefits
Learn more about benefits at Google.
- Drive execution of high-impact, visible data projects, establishing the technical strategy and investment road-map for sustainable YouTube Ads growth.
- Architect cost-efficient, sub-linear data and logging infrastructure capable of managing millions of Queries Per Second (QPS) for model training, billing, and reporting.
- Deliver critical data solutions, including low-latency streaming datasets and improving end-to-end log freshness from over 40 hours to under 6 hours.
- Collaborate with executive leaders and product teams across the organization to unify workflows, ensure compliance, and maximize Return on Investment (ROI).
- Guide and mentor team engineers while directly contributing to technical design, coding, and solving ambiguous, complex technical problems.
Minimum qualifications:
- Bachelor's degree or equivalent practical experience.
- 8 years of experience programming in C++.
- 3 years of experience with software design and architecture.
- 5 years of experience building and developing large-scale infrastructure and large-scale distributed systems.
- Experience with storage systems.
Preferred qualifications:
- Master’s degree or PhD in Engineering, Computer Science, or a related technical field.
- 3 years of experience in a technical leadership role leading project teams and setting technical direction.
- 3 years of experience working in a complex, matrixed organization involving cross-functional, or cross-business projects.
- Experience in people management.
- Experience in data analytics, preferably with Google analytics.
- Experience working with compute infrastructure.